SUMMARY:FAB Festival - Celebrating Everyday Creativity
DESCRIPTION:FAB Festival is a vibrant, one-day celebration at the Rideau Community Hub designed for families, showcasing the ingenuity and creativity of our local community.



Highlights include exhibitions by local makers and artists, interactive workshops, and family-friendly entertainment.

Planned Activities




Cafeteria:

An exhibition hall for creators and makers to show and tell about their projects! Visit this link to learn more about the exhibitors.





Drama room:

The drama room will be home to live musical and theatrical performances.





Incubator 13 (Room 124):

This space will be converted into a place where indigenous traditional crafts seamlessly blends with modern day technology. Incubator13 will be the host to workshops run by FabLab Onaki, the first indigenous FabLab in Canada.





RRCRC Community Kitchen:

The community kitchen will host Chef Ric&#039;s and Social Harvest.
